Kenneth David “Kenny” Adams, 62, of Patoka passed away Thursday, September 10, 2026, at St. Louis University Hospital. He was born on March 6, 1964, in Centralia, the son of David and Jane (Edwards) Adams.
Survivors include his mother, Jane Adams of Patoka; his children, Kyle D. Adams of Patoka, and Katie Adams of Centralia; grandchildren, Paisley Ella, Zoey Lynn, Maverick Lee, and Lucas David; brother, Mark Adams of Vandalia; his dog, Hank; and extended family and friends.
Kenny was preceded in death by his father, David Adams.
Kenny was the guy you could always count on. He was an icon in his hometown of Patoka and loved by everyone who ever knew him. He was crafty, building many flagpoles that could be seen with the flag flying all around Patoka. Kenny enjoyed the thrill of the hunt every deer season. He was a true social butterfly, talking easily with friends, family and strangers alike. He appreciated his loyal companion and best friend, his dog, Hank. Kenny liked to work on demo cars and was a strong competitor in demo derbies. Kenny loved most of all spending time with his grandchildren, watching them grow and making sure they each knew how much they were loved each day. Kenny will be deeply missed, and his legacy of strength, loyalty, and friendliness will live on in the hearts of all his friends and family.
A celebration of life service will be held at 1:00 p.m. Wednesday, September 16, 2026, at the Day Macz Funeral Home in Patoka with Pastor Sam Hester officiating. Interment will follow at Patoka City Cemetery. Relatives and friends are welcome to attend the visitation from 11:00 a.m. until the time of the service on Wednesday at the funeral home in Patoka.
